Let's forge ahead with one love, unity

It is a common everyday topic to put down our country and the new Government in power and say how it is going to the dogs.

There may be corruption from the highest to the lowest, and this will be dealt with accordingly by the institutions charged with this responsibility. But where does all this negative talk and negativism lead us? What is 50 years in the life of a nation? Those born free are still in their 20s and 30s, and the older ones are gradually shedding their slave mentality.

Faith brooks no fear, and the God-given creative power within the individual is the outcome of triple faith: in God, in self and humanity.

Let us move forward and look towards the next 30-50 years; where do we see ourselves as a young, fledgling, democratic nation among countries like USA, which is now 235 years old, and the countries of Europe, which are over 500 years old.

Look at the progress, we have made over the last 50 years; the Almighty has blessed our nation with natural wealth and natural talent in the creativity of our people. Let us not look back and continue to criticise and condemn one another but forge ahead with the guiding principles and watchwords of our founding father, Dr Eric Williams, viz "Discipline, Tolerance and Production".

If we have no faith in one another, we will always be surrounded by hostility and fear, and there will be a tendency to withdraw from society and cling to our families and friends for protection. But we are a fun-loving people, hospitable, generous and kind. Let us be respectful to the authorities, our parents, our elders and our teachers, for they are the ones who have moulded this nation to date.

This is basic fear (fear personified) in the society today. The cause of this unnecessary fear and anxiety is well known to be crime and poverty. However, we are a free people, and we can only overcome this fear by faith and love of our fellow human beings, not selfish love but universal love that brings with it "heavenly bliss".

Love is its own record and hatred is its own punishment. Hatred is like weeds, it grows with astounding profusion, unless smothered by love. For all this "talk", talk is getting us nowhere, we all have our likes and dislikes, and we will not agree on everything that is taking place in our society today, but let us agree to disagree.

Let us raise our levels of consciousness and move away from the politics of the "gutter". As we move forward, let us extend warmth, friendship and "One Love".

Let us put aside our fears and hatred and build a nation that our children and grandchildren will be proud of. If we love our country, Trinidad and Tobago, sacrifices must be made. So let's reach out and help one another; we are a fantastic people with tremendous potential and native intelligence.

May the Almighty continue to bless us on this specific occasion and continue to bless us in abundance.

We should be proud today for what we have achieved and thank those in the past who have contributed to our many achievements in every sphere and endeavour.

Peace, love and blessings on our 50th birthday as a nation.
